What you'll do

The Operating Room Control Desk Coordinator is responsible for managing and overseeing the logistical flow of surgical procedures within the operating room control room. This role ensures efficient communication, coordination of surgical schedules, and resource allocation to facilitate optimal surgical operations.

Essential Job Functions

  • Scheduling and Coordination: Organize and maintain the surgical schedule, ensuring timely preparation and readiness of operating rooms.
  • Establishes and maintains good communications with patients, families/visitors and hospital staff.
    • Reports vital information to all levels of the healthcare team as needed as evidenced by feedback from healthcare team members and observed by supervisor.
    • Conveys needed information to patients and visitors, measured by patient and co-worker feedback.
    • Maintains good communication with co-workers for proper team functioning as evidenced by feedback from healthcare team members and observed by supervisor.
    • Act as a liaison between surgeons, anesthesiologists, nursing staff, and other departments to ensure seamless operations.
  • Provides clinical and service support to providers/healthcare team members and patients.
    • Establishes and maintains an organized, functional work environment.
    • Track surgical progress and timelines, adjusting schedules as needed to optimize patient flow.
    • Answers telephone in a timely, courteous manner, and relays messages to appropriate personnel.
    • Performs and/or supports unit based audits.
    • Supports interdepartmental patient flow process.
    • Address any issues that arise during surgeries, implementing solutions to maintain efficiency and patient safety.
    • Support workflow processes for providers and healthcare team members.
    • Performs patient service initiatives.
  • Collaborates with Nurse Manager to support adherence to unit budget.
    • Completes all unit specific and department competency requirements.
    • Attends relevant educational and training programs.
    • Communicates effectively with patients and visitors.
    • Maintain the confidentiality of patient's information.
    • Directing/transporting patients and visitors to the right location.
    • Keep patients and family members updated in delays and schedule changes.
    • Answer basic patient/family inquiries.
    • Order medical, paper and dietary supplies as needed.
    • Assist with monitoring and allocation of supplies, equipment, and personnel, ensuring availability for all surgical procedures.
    • Coordinate with various departments to ensure proper flow of patients.
  • Performs similar or related duties as requested or directed.
    • Performs other duties as requested and observed by supervisor or manager.
    • Prints daily OR schedule, patient stickers and name bands.
    • Assists with the unit's admission processes for the pre surgical/pre procedural patient.
    • Prepare charts for the next day cases.
What we need from you
Education:
  • High School or GED, preferred
Experience:
  • Minimum 1 year of Previous experience in a health-related position, knowledge of medical terminology and scheduling patients. Completion of 1 year of RN program can be substituted for experience, required
  • Experience in an OR or Surgical scheduling setting, preferred
Licensure/Certifications:
  • BLS or Heart Saver with AED must be obtained within 6 months from date of hire, required
Skills:
  • Communication
  • Interacting with People
  • Computer Skills
  • Reliability
  • Time Management
Physical Requirements:
  • Heavy Work - Exerting up to 100 lbs. of force occasionally, and/or up to 50 lbs of force frequently, and/or up to 20 lbs, of force constantly to move objects
  • Occasional balancing, repetitive motion, and stooping
  • Frequent crouching, typing/clerical/dexterity, grasping, hearing, kneeling, lifting, pulling, pushing, reaching, seeing/monitor/computer use, standing, talking, visual acuity (color, depth, perception), and walking
  • Constant fit testing
Hazards:
  • Occasional bodily fluids/bloodborne exposure and radiation/radiant energy
Travel:
  • No Travel Required
